About the company

Bajaj Auto Limited is an Indian multinational automotive manufacturing company based in Pune. It manufactures
motorcycles, scooters and auto rickshaws. Bajaj Auto is a part of the Bajaj Group. It was founded by Jamnalal Bajaj
(1889–1942) in Rajasthan in the 1940s. Bajaj Auto is the world's third-largest manufacturer of motorcycles and the second-
largest in India. It is the world's largest three-wheeler manufacturer. In December 2020, Bajaj Auto crossed a market
capitalisation of ₹1 trillion (US$13 billion), making it the world's most valuable two-wheeler company.

Recent Updates:
• Bajaj Auto launches India-made Triumph bikes, shares jump to record high.
• Bajaj Auto June sales fall 2% YoY to 3.4 lakh units on lower exports; two-wheeler sales decline 7%.
• Bajaj Auto’s domestic sales for the month increased 45% to 1,99,983 units from 1,38,351 units, while exports
fell 32% to 1,40,998 units from 2,08,653 units, YoY.
• Bajaj Auto's standalone net profit fell 2% to Rs 1,433 crore for the quarter ended March. It was Rs 1,469 crore
in the same period last year.
• The company's operating profit rose 26% to Rs 1,718 crore for the reporting quarter as against Rs 1,365 crore a
year ago.
• Three-wheeler sales crossed the 100,000 units milestone for the first time since the pandemic, reflecting the
strong rebound to pre-Covid levels for Bajaj.
• The company has surplus cash of Rs 17,445 crore as of March 2023.

Dupont Summary
• ROE has decreased in 7 years from 25.60% to 20.47% with the decrease in net profit margins from 18.75% in
FY2017 to 16.62% in FY2023.
• Asset efficiency remained constant and the net profit margins has decreased making reason for fall in ROE.
• ROA has decreased from 20.99% in FY2017 to 17.25% in FY2023. The reason for this decrease is due to the
fall in net profit margins of the company.
